Which banks offer education loan for PGDip in New Zealand?
I am going to New Zealand for Masters of International Business. According to NZ educational system first year is considered as PGDip and second year is Masters. I enquired in SBI and they denied loan for PGdip. I enquired more and got to know that all banks don't provide loan for PGDip. Is it true?
Hi Nikhil.it seems you are going to AIS St. Helens.well yes SBI does trouble students in giving education loans for courses such as a PG Diploma. But you can consider banks such as Oriental Bank of Commerce, Central Bank of India & Allahabad Bank. Most of our students have got loans from these banks for Diploma programs without any problem. The loan amount etc will depend on the bank's loan criteria & will largely be based on your/your sponsor's ability to repay as well availability of collateral security with you. Hi, Now a days almost all the banks offer education loan to students, to pursue their education in India or Abroad. The banks offer maximum loan of Rs 10 Lac for education in India and Rs 20 Lac for education abroad. The repayment period vary from 5-7 years. The bank do not ask for any collateral security up to the amount of Rs4 lac, but if the amount exceeds Rs 4 lac then the bank will ask for collateral security. The repayment of the loan amount starts after 6 months of completion of course or after 6 months of getting job, which ever is earlier. I hope this answers your query.
